Summary: Aims to provide knowledge and understanding for caregivers of Alzheimer's sufererers. Describes the brain, and the brain damage suffered by patients; details the signs and symptoms of the disease, and discusses the diagnostic process. Describes the reaction of relatives etc. following the diagnosis, as a process that includes denial, anger, depression, bargaining and finally, acceptance. Describes the progression of Alzheimer's, and provides care-giving strategies. Includes glossary.
